找回密码
 立即注册

QQ登录

只需一步,快速开始

品茗-3

金牌服务用户

37

主题

95

帖子

344

积分

金牌服务用户

积分
344
品茗-3
金牌服务用户   /  发表于:2019-4-25 17:10  /   查看:3599  /  回复:4
本帖最后由 品茗-3 于 2019-4-25 17:11 编辑

请问spread的哪个接口方法能清理所有注册事件?
事件本身 -= 方法除外,因为这样太麻烦,要把所有+=的一个个清掉。

demo: Demo.rar (12.92 MB, 下载次数: 149)

4 个回复

倒序浏览
dexteryao讲师达人认证 悬赏达人认证 SpreadJS 开发认证
超级版主   /  发表于:2019-4-25 17:41:20
沙发
Reset只是重置控件模板,并不会重置事件,设计的时候加载不同模板,事件不用重新绑定。如果要所有事件也解除绑定建议重新new spread对象,原来的销毁掉。
回复 使用道具 举报
lkxtracy
金牌服务用户   /  发表于:2019-4-26 13:14:37
板凳
dexteryao 发表于 2019-4-25 17:41
Reset只是重置控件模板,并不会重置事件,设计的时候加载不同模板,事件不用重新绑定。如果要所有事件也解 ...

Reset函数调用以后,SheetView、Cell等这些子对象的事件是怎么处理的
回复 使用道具 举报
lkxtracy
金牌服务用户   /  发表于:2019-4-26 13:16:30
地板
dexteryao 发表于 2019-4-25 17:41
Reset只是重置控件模板,并不会重置事件,设计的时候加载不同模板,事件不用重新绑定。如果要所有事件也解 ...

请问Spread 12的年中版本什么时候发布?之前询问说是4月份会发布。但是没看到官网有更新。这个更新我们提交了一个比较重要的Bug
回复 使用道具 举报
dexteryao讲师达人认证 悬赏达人认证 SpreadJS 开发认证
超级版主   /  发表于:2019-4-26 13:45:25
5#
还没发布,延期到5月了,具体日期现在还没有。SheetView、Cell这些对象已经没了,所以事件也没了,需要重新再绑定。
回复 使用道具 举报
您需要登录后才可以回帖 登录 | 立即注册
返回顶部